Give : ) lia must work at least 5 hours per week in her family’s restaurant for $8 per hour. she also does yard work for $12 per hour. lia’s parents allow her to work a maximum of 15 hours per week overall. lia’s goal is to earn at least $120 per week. 1.)write a system of inequalities to represent this situation. let r be the number of hours worked at the restaurant, and let y be the number of hours of yard work. 2.)graph the inequalities. 3.)what is the maximum number of hours lia can work at the restaurant and still meet her earnings goal? explain. 4.)what is the maximum amount of money lia can earn in 1 week? explain.
